Airlines with Flights to Bermuda

There are eight airlines that make regular trips to Bermuda.

These include the four major US airlines with American Airlines, Jet Blue and Delta making daily visits for most of the year while United Airlines offers seasonal flights during the summer. As of 2023, local airline BermudAir, has started service to multiple US destinations and Canada since early 2024.

lIf you’re looking for flights to Bermuda from Canada you’ll be able to book flights through Air Canada or BermudAiras WestJet no longer flys to the island. The schedule for Air Canada varies throughout the year with service from Toronto while BermudAir is slowly increasing flights to Toronto in addition to Halifax; a route which has not been available on island for over a decade.

For visitors from Europe and beyond, British Airways is the only regular flights to Bermuda scheduled from outside of North America. There are flights on Sata Air that are available a few times during the summer and Christmas period.

The number of flights available to Bermuda can vary throughout the year with airlines adjusting schedules or routes based on demand.

Gateways to Bermuda

Most of the flights flying to Bermuda come from the US. There are many cities along the Eastern Seaboard that offer direct flights to the island. Of those cities New York, Charlotte and Atlanta are the most common routes. You can also book flights from Boston, Philadelphia, Newark and Miami depending on the time of year. When flying from these cities, flights are usually between 1.5 – 2 hours which makes Bermuda a much closer island destination than those in the Caribbean.

Outside of the USA, you will be able to catch flights to Bermuda from Toronto or London year round and the Azores less frequently.

Bermuda’s Airport

The new terminal at L.F. Wade International Airport was opened in December 2020. This world class facility offers many of the amenities you will find in at other international airports; stay connected with free wifi and numerous electrical outlets, grab a bite before your flight at the Rock & Barrel Gastrobar or find last minute souvenirs at Somers Isle Trading Company. You can also relax in the PrimeClass Lounge.

When arriving to the island you will be able to buy duty free items once you’ve gone through Bermuda customs. Taxis will be waiting for you outside the terminal if you haven’t arranged a pick up in advance. When departing it is recommended to arrive 2-3 hours before your scheduled flight. Travellers heading to the US will go through US Customs on island meaning there’s one less thing to do when you arrive at your destination.

Time to Fly

Flying to Bermuda is a great way to experience the island. When compared to a cruise you’re able to spend as much time as you wish and won’t have to spend multiple days at sea. The close proximity to the US makes it a great place for a weekend trip. You’ll be able to leave in the morning and be relaxing on a beach by mid afternoon. There are many accommodation options from hotels and guest houses to Airbnbs, wherever you stay you’ll never be too far from the ocean or the many other attractions that make Bermuda so great. With multiple daily flights from the US, flying to Bermuda is easy wherever you live.
